A cylinder is a solid figure with straight parallel sides and a circular or oval cross section with a radius (r) and a height (h). The volume of a cylinder is π r2h and the surface area is 2(π r2) + 2π rh.

Factor y2 + 6y - 7
| (y - 1)(y - 7) | |
| (y + 1)(y - 7) | |
| (y - 1)(y + 7) | |
| (y + 1)(y + 7) |
To factor a quadratic expression, apply the FOIL method (First, Outside, Inside, Last) in reverse. First, find the two Last terms that will multiply to produce -7 as well and sum (Inside, Outside) to equal 6. For this problem, those two numbers are -1 and 7. Then, plug these into a set of binomials using the square root of the First variable (y2):
y2 + 6y - 7
y2 + (-1 + 7)y + (-1 x 7)
(y - 1)(y + 7)

A parallelogram is a quadrilateral with two sets of parallel sides. Opposite sides (a = c, b = d) and angles (red = red, blue = blue) are equal. The area of a parallelogram is base x height and the perimeter is the sum of the lengths of all sides (a + b + c + d).
